Output 40160ca9887d69c6b67716be4ef3e6b23cd37323ba16e3086bb21c090652d959:62

value
164895848
script pubkey
OP_0 OP_PUSHBYTES_20 15c4b906c5c43043256270d364f127c4bf294e28
address
bc1qzhztjpk9cscyxftzwrfkfuf8cjljjn3garxfz0
transaction
40160ca9887d69c6b67716be4ef3e6b23cd37323ba16e3086bb21c090652d959
spent
true